Buscar

PIM_IV_ UNIP_ ADS_2019

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 37 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 37 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 9, do total de 37 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

5
UNIP INTERATIVA
Projeto Integrado Multidisciplinar
Cursos Superiores de Tecnologia
DESENVOLVIMENTO DE SISTEMA PARA VENDA DE INGRESSO TEATRO MAJESTIC
UNIP Polo Japão
2019
UNIP INTERATIVA
Projeto Integrado Multidisciplinar
Cursos Superiores de Tecnologia
DESENVOLVIMENTO DE SISTEMA PARA VENDA DE INGRESSO TEATRO MAJESTIC
Nome: Matheus Tomio Carneiro Matsushita
RA: 0512673
Curso: Analise e Desenvolvimento de Sistemas
Semestre: 1º Semestre
UNIP Polo Japão
2019
RESUMO
O seguinte trabalho, proposto pela universidade UNIP Interativa, tem como objetivo o desenvolvimento de um sistema de vendas de ingresso de um teatro, no qual possui uma tabela de valor para as peças onde se aplicará desconto de 50% para crianças de 0 a 12 anos, adultos a partir de 60 anos, estudantes e professores da rede pública de ensino, além de também conceder gratuidade em ingressos para crianças carentes da rede pública de ensino em dias de terças-feiras.
O projeto desenvolvido com base em linguagem C apresenta informações como cadeiras vagas, ocupadas, indisponibilidade de vagas, quantidade de ingressos vendidos, informação geral da peça e gestão de fechamento de caixa. 
Palavras – chave: Tecnologia, Projeto, Linguagem C, Teatro.
ABSTRACT
	The following work, proposed by UNIP Interativa University, aims to develop a theater ticket sales system, which has a value table for the spectacle where 50% discount will apply to children from 0 to 12 years old, adults over 60 yars old, public school students and teachers, as well as free admission for underprivileged children from public schools on Tuesday days.
	The project developed based on C language presents information such as vacant, occupied seats, unavailability of seats, number of tickets sold, general part information and cash management.
Keywords: Technology, Project, Language C, Theater.
LISTA DE FIGURAS
Figura 1 – Fluxograma 1 .............................................................................................9
Figura 2 – Fluxograma 2 ...........................................................................................10
Figura 3 – Fluxograma 3 ...........................................................................................11
Figura 4 - Fluxograma 4 ............................................................................................11
Figura 5 - Fluxograma 5 ............................................................................................12
Figura 6 - Fluxograma 6 ............................................................................................13
Figura 7 - Fluxograma 7 ............................................................................................13
Figura 8 - Fluxograma 7.1 .........................................................................................14
Figura 9 - Fluxograma 7.2..........................................................................................14
Figura 10 - Fluxograma 7.3 .......................................................................................15
Figura 11 - Fluxograma 7.4 .......................................................................................15
Figura 12 -Fluxograma 7.5 ........................................................................................16
Figura 13 - Fluxograma 7.6 .......................................................................................16
Figura 14 - Fluxograma 7.7 .......................................................................................17
Figura 15 - Fluxograma 7.8 .......................................................................................17
Figura 16 - Fluxograma 8 ..........................................................................................18
Figura 17 - Fluxograma 8.1 .......................................................................................18
Figura 18 - Fluxograma 8.2 .......................................................................................19
Figura 19 - Fluxograma 8.3 .......................................................................................19
Figura 20 - Fluxograma 9...........................................................................................20
Figura 21 - Fluxograma 10 ........................................................................................20
Figura 22 - Fluxograma 10.1 .....................................................................................21
Figura 23 - Fluxograma 10.2 .....................................................................................21
Figura 24 - Tela DEV C++ 1 ......................................................................................22
Figura 25 - Tela DEV C++ 2 ......................................................................................22
Figura 26 - Tela DEV C++ 3 ......................................................................................23
Figura 27 - Tela DEV C++ 4.......................................................................................23
Figura 28 - Tela DEV C++ 5 ......................................................................................24
Figura 29 - Tela DEV C++ 6 ......................................................................................24
Figura 30 - Tela DEV C++ 7 ......................................................................................25
Figura 31 - Menu inicial .............................................................................................25
Figura 32 - Compra ingresso .....................................................................................26
Figura 33 - Ingresso criança 1....................................................................................26
Figura 34 - Ingresso criança 2 ...................................................................................27
Figura 35 - Ingresso Professor ..................................................................................27
Figura 36 - Ingresso Idoso..........................................................................................28 
Figura 37 - Ingresso criança carente 3ª – feira..........................................................28
Figura 38 - Ingresso adulto ........................................................................................29
Figura 39 - Vendas do dia parte 1 .............................................................................29
Figura 40 - Vendas dia parte 2 ..................................................................................30
Figura 41 - Consulta de horário e assentos ..............................................................30
Figura 42 - Fechamento de caixa resumido ..............................................................31
SUMÁRIO	
1.	INTRODUÇÃO	7
2.	TIPO DE SISTEMA	7
3.	CICLO DE VIDA	7
4.	REPRESENTAÇÃO LÓGICA NARRATIVA	8
5.	FLUXOGRAMA	9
6.	TELA DEV C++	21
7. TELA DO PROGRAMA	25
CONCLUSÃO	31
REFERÊNCIAS BIBLIOGRÁFICAS	31
INTRODUÇÃO
Com a finalidade de melhorar a gestão financeira e distribuição de ingressos, foi desenvolvido um sistema de vendas para o teatro Majestic. 
Analisando a necessidade do estabelecimento, realizou-se a criação de um programa baseado em linguagem C, com interface intuitiva, de simples operação e que atenderá a necessidade da empresa.
O software conta com um menu principal com opção de venda de ingressos, consulta de vendas, consultar horário de exibição de um espetáculo, disponibilidade de assento e o gerenciamento de caixa com registro de vendas e movimentação do dia. 
Logo, o procedimento de atendimento ao publico se tornará mais eficiente, rápido, com menos chances de erro, facilitando também a consulta de movimentação de clientes, valores e fechamento de caixa. 
TIPO DE SISTEMA	
Analisando o cenário apresentado, foi escolhido um sistema STP (Sistema de Processamento de Transações) por conta de suas características: Tempo de resposta rápida para atender de forma mais ágil os clientes;Confiabilidade por possuir menos chances de erro, não existir vazamento de informações ou cobrança de valor indevida. Inflexibilidade, pois não há outra forma de realizar a venda, aplicar desconto e gratuidade se não seguir as etapas exigidas pelo sistema; Armazenamento e recuperação de informação permitindo que o operador possa consultar vendas de ingresso, horário e nome da peça. 
Com esse tipo de aplicação, cria-se assim um padrão que o atendente precisa seguir para a venda de ingresso.
CICLO DE VIDA
Quanto ao ciclo de vida do software, fez-se a coleta de informação do que o cliente precisava, avaliou-se o nicho a ser trabalhado, softwares e hardware já possuídos pelo estabelecimento e optou-se pelo modelo sequencial linear (cascata), pois ao receber a proposta, já estavam bem definidas as necessidades e objetivos do cliente, facilitando a organização, estruturação, planejamento e arquitetura do código a ser trabalhado . Ao finalizar o projeto foi realizado teste e consecutivamente a manutenção no código fonte. 
REPRESENTAÇÃO LÓGICA NARRATIVA
1) Menu principal (Compra; Consultar vendas; consulta de horário e assentos disponíveis e fechamento de caixa); 
2) Escolha de Opção 1;
a. Apresentar lista de peças com horários e quantidades de assentos;
b. Digitar código de peça;
c. Nome do espectador;
d. Idade;
e. Aplicar ou não desconto conforme idade;
f. Perguntar se é estudante;
g. Aplicar ou não desconto baseado em resposta;	
h. Perguntar se é professor de rede publica;
i. Aplicar ou não desconto baseado em reposta;
j. Perguntar se é aluno de rede publica em uma terça –feira;
k. Aplicar ou não desconto baseado em resposta;
l. Imprimir informações de ingresso;
m. Pressione qualquer tecla para continuar;
n. Retornar a menu principal.
3) Escolha de Opção 2;
a. Imprimir em tela lista de ingressos vendidos (Codigo de peça, número de assento, nome da peça, nome de espectador, idade e valor.);
b. Pressione qualquer tecla para continuar;
c. Retornar ao menu principal.
4) Escolha de opção 3;
a. Imprimir em tela lista de peças, horário e assentos disponíveis;
b. Pressione qualquer tecla para continuar;
c. Retornar ao menu principal.
5) Escolha de opção 4;
a.Imprimir na tela (fechamento de caixa, mensagem de resumo financeiro	com quantidade de ingressos vendidos e valor total de vendas);
b. Pressionar qualquer tecla para continuar;
c. Encerrar sistema.
FLUXOGRAMA 
Figura 1 – Fluxograma 1.
Fonte – O autor.
Figura 2 – Fluxograma 2.
Fonte – O autor.
Figura 3 – Fluxograma 3.
Fonte – O autor.
Figura 4 - Fluxograma 4.
Fonte – O autor.
Figura 5 – Fluxograma 5.
Fonte – O autor.
Figura 6 – Fluxograma 6.
Fonte – O autor.
Figura 7 – Fluxograma 7.
Fonte – O autor.
Figura 8 – Fluxograma 7.1
Fonte – O autor.
Figura 9 – Fluxograma 7.2
Fonte – O autor.
Figura 10 – Fluxograma 7.3.
Fonte – O autor.
Figura 11 – Fluxograma 7.4.
Fonte – O autor.
Figura 12 – Fluxograma 7.5.
Fonte – O autor.
Figura 13 - Fluxograma 7.6. 
Fonte – O autor.
Figura 14 – Fluxograma 7.7
Fonte – O autor.
Figura 15 – Fluxograma 7.8.
Fonte – O autor.
Figura 16 – Fluxograma 8. 
Fonte – O autor.
Figura 17 – Fluxograma 8.1.
Fonte – O autor.
Figura 18 – Fluxograma 8.2.
Fonte – O autor.
Figura 19 – Fluxograma 8.3.
Fonte – O autor.
Figura 20 – Fluxograma 9.
Fonte – O autor.
Figura 21 – Fluxograma 10.
Fonte – O autor.
Figura 22 – Fluxograma 10.1.
Fonte – O autor.
Figura 23 – Fluxograma 10.2.
Fonte – O autor.
TELA DEV C++
Figura 24 – Tela DEV C++ 1.Fonte – O autor.
Figura 25 – Tela DEV C++ 2.Fonte – O autor.
Figura 26 – Tela DEV C++ 3. Fonte – O autor.
Figura 27 – Tela DEV C++ 4. Fonte – O autor.
Figura 28 – Tela DEV C++ 5. Fonte – O autor.
Figura 29 – Tela DEV C++ 6. Fonte – O autor.
Figura 30 – Tela DEV C++ 7. Fonte – O autor.
7. TELA DO PROGRAMA
Figura 31 – Menu inicial.
Fonte – O autor.
Figura 32 – Compra ingresso.
Fonte – O autor.
Figura 33 – Ingresso criança 1.
Fonte – O autor.
Figura 34 – Ingresso criança 2.
Fonte – O autor.
Figura 35 – Ingresso Professor.
Fonte – O autor.
Figura 36 – Ingresso Idoso. 
Fonte – O autor.
Figura 37 – Ingresso criança carente 3ª – feira. 
Fonte – O autor.
Figura 38 – Ingresso adulto.
Fonte – O autor.
Figura 39 – Vendas do dia parte 1.
Fonte – O autor.
Figura 40 – Vendas dia parte 2.
Fonte – O autor.
Figura 41 – Consulta de horário e assentos.
Fonte – O autor.
Figura 42 – Fechamento de caixa resumido.
Fonte – O autor.
CONCLUSÃO
Após desenvolvimento do sistema, análise de cenário, testes e execução do produto final. É possível notar que a implantação do sistema desenvolvido além de facilitar, agilizar e padronizar o sistema de vendas de ingresso tonará o trabalho de fechamento de caixa e gestão financeira mais fácil e prática.
Concluo que as mudanças realizadas após a implantação do sistema no teatro apresentaram resultados interessantes e satisfatórios de modo que os objetivos colocados foram alcançados e os problemas solucionados de maneira eficaz.
REFERÊNCIAS BIBLIOGRÁFICAS
Costa, Ivanir; Souza, Luciano Soares de; Nogueira, Marcelo. Engenharia de Software I. São Paulo, Ed. Sol, 2014.
Ito, Olavo; Souza, Luciano Soares de; Nogueira, Marcelo. Linguagem e Técnicas de Programação. São Paulo, Ed. Sol, 2014.
SEVERINO, Antônio Joaquim. Metodologia do trabalho científico. 22. ed. ver. e ampl. São Paulo: Cortez, 2002.

Continue navegando